Analysis

In 2024, wood-based panels — import value in Caribbean stood at 236,147 1000 USD. That is the highest value across all 64 years on record.

The figure is up 8.9% on the previous year and up 56.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, wood-based panels — import value in Caribbean peaked at 236,147 1000 USD in 2024 and was at its lowest, 2,921 1000 USD, in 1962.

That places Caribbean 39th out of 236 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 4,937 1000 USD 2,921 1000 USD 8,750 1000 USD 9
1970s 18,516 1000 USD 9,506 1000 USD 41,567 1000 USD 10
1980s 66,210 1000 USD 45,641 1000 USD 81,098 1000 USD 10
1990s 75,622 1000 USD 51,741 1000 USD 97,455 1000 USD 10
2000s 112,207 1000 USD 88,965 1000 USD 162,518 1000 USD 10
2010s 160,309 1000 USD 141,584 1000 USD 190,213 1000 USD 10
2020s 208,426 1000 USD 146,151 1000 USD 236,147 1000 USD 5

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
